1. Optimize Your Profile for Maximum Impact
Your Instagram profile is the first impression you make on potential followers. Ensure your username is easy to remember and reflects your brand. Use a high-quality profile picture, preferably your logo or a professional headshot. Write a compelling bio that clearly states who you are, what you do, and includes a call-to-action (CTA) such as a link to your website or a recent campaign.
2. Post Consistently and at Optimal Times
Consistency is key to maintaining and growing your Instagram presence. Develop a content calendar to plan your posts in advance. Posting at optimal times when your audience is most active can significantly increase engagement. Use Instagram Insights to determine the best times for your specific audience.
3. Leverage High-Quality Visual Content
Instagram is a visual platform, so the quality of your content matters. Invest in good photography or graphic design to create eye-catching posts. Use a consistent aesthetic or theme to make your profile visually cohesive. This not only attracts followers but also encourages them to engage with your content.
4. Utilize Instagram Stories and Reels
Instagram Stories and Reels are powerful tools for increasing visibility and engagement. Stories allow you to share behind-the-scenes content, polls, and Q&A sessions, while Reels can help you reach a broader audience through trending audio and creative content. Regularly using these features can keep your audience engaged and attract new followers.
5. Engage with Your Audience
Engagement is a two-way street. Respond to comments and direct messages promptly to build a loyal community. Like and comment on posts from your followers and other accounts in your niche. This not only increases your visibility but also fosters a sense of connection and loyalty among your audience.
6. Use Relevant Hashtags
Hashtags are essential for increasing the discoverability of your posts. Research and use relevant hashtags that are popular within your niche. Avoid using overly generic hashtags, as they may not attract your target audience. A mix of popular and niche-specific hashtags can help you reach a broader yet relevant audience.
7. Collaborate with Influencers and Brands
Collaborations can significantly boost your Instagram presence. Partner with influencers or brands that align with your values and target audience. This can expose your profile to a new audience and increase your credibility. Consider hosting giveaways or joint campaigns to maximize the impact of your collaborations.
8. Analyze and Adjust Your Strategy
Regularly analyze your Instagram performance using Instagram Insights. Track metrics such as engagement rate, follower growth, and post reach to understand what works and what doesn’t. Adjust your strategy based on these insights to continuously improve your Instagram presence.
9. Run Instagram Ads
If you have the budget, running Instagram ads can be an effective way to gain more followers and likes. Target your ads to a specific audience based on demographics, interests, and behaviors. Use compelling visuals and clear CTAs to encourage users to follow your account or engage with your content.
10. Stay Updated with Instagram Trends
Instagram is constantly evolving, so it’s crucial to stay updated with the latest trends and features. Experiment with new features such as Guides, Shopping Tags, or IGTV to keep your content fresh and engaging. Staying ahead of trends can give you a competitive edge and help you attract more followers.
